学编程的前期准备什么学历

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程并没有严格的前期准备要求,学历并不是唯一的决定因素。然而,对于一些特定的编程职位,如大型软件开发项目或科学研究领域,可能会更加重视学历。

    以下是学习编程的前期准备建议:

    1. 基础数学知识:编程需要一定的数学基础,特别是数学逻辑和离散数学。对于算法、数据结构等高级编程概念的理解非常重要。因此,掌握基础的数学知识是非常有帮助的。

    2. 自学能力:编程是一种学习不断、自我驱动的领域。无论你有无相关学历,培养自学能力非常重要。通过阅读教科书、参与在线教育平台、实践编程项目等方式,持续学习和提升自己的编程技能。

    3. 编程基础:掌握基本的编程概念和技术是开始学习编程的基础。学习常见的编程语言,如Python、Java、C++等,并掌握基础语法、数据类型、控制流、函数等概念。

    4. 实践项目经验:通过实际的编程项目来应用你所学的知识。参与开源项目或者自己创建小型项目,锻炼和展示你的编程能力。这将为你今后找工作提供宝贵的经验,并证明你的能力。

    5. 学习资源:利用互联网上的丰富教育资源来学习编程。有很多在线编程课程、教学视频和博客文章可供选择。结合使用不同的学习资源,可以帮助你更好地理解和掌握编程知识。

    尽管学历在学习编程方面并不是必需的,但它可能会在一些就业机会上起到帮助。一些大型科技公司可能更看重计算机科学或相关学科的学位。但无论你的学历如何,真正重要的是你的编程能力和经验。

    通过不断学习和实践,不论你是否有相关学历,都能够成为一名优秀的程序员。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学编程的前期准备并不一定需要特定的学历。虽然拥有相关的学历可能会使得找工作或者学习过程中更加容易一些,但并不是必要的条件。实际上,很多成功的程序员并没有相关的学历,而是通过自学或者参加在线编程课程来获得编程技能。

    以下是学习编程的前期准备的五个重要方面:

    1. 自我动力和学习能力:学习编程需要耐心和自我驱动力。编程是一项技术性很强的工作,需要终身学习和不断更新自己的知识。拥有良好的学习能力和自我驱动力将在学习编程的过程中起到关键作用。

    2. 数学基础:尽管不是所有的编程领域都需要深厚的数学知识,但在某些领域,如机器学习、数据分析和算法设计等方面,具备良好的数学基础是必不可少的。学习编程之前,你可以先掌握一些基本的数学知识,例如代数、几何和概率统计。

    3. 计算机科学基础知识:了解计算机科学的基本概念和原理对于学习编程非常重要。这些概念包括数据结构、算法、计算原理、操作系统和网络等。可以通过阅读相关的书籍、参加线上课程或者观看视频教程来学习这些基础知识。

    4. 编程语言选择:选择一门合适的编程语言开始学习编程。目前流行的编程语言包括Python、Java、C++、JavaScript等。每种语言都有其特点和应用领域,在选择时可以考虑自己的兴趣和未来的发展方向,选择一门适合自己的编程语言进行学习。

    5. 实践和项目经验:学习编程最重要的一步是进行实践。通过编写代码并参与项目,你可以将理论知识应用到实际中,提升自己的实际操作能力。可以参与开源项目、参加编程竞赛或者自己做一些小项目来积累实践经验。

    总之,学习编程的准备并不只局限于学历问题,而是需要具备自我动力、学习能力以及对计算机科学和编程的基础知识的掌握。通过不断实践和学习,你可以逐渐提升自己的编程技能,实现自己在编程领域的发展。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程不一定需要特定的学历要求。虽然某些学历(例如计算机科学、软件工程、电气工程等相关专业)可能会给你提供更好的基础知识和技能,但在计算机领域,技能和经验更为重要。

    下面是一些学习编程前期的准备工作:

    1. 扎实的数学基础:在编程领域,数学是一门重要的学科。掌握基础的数学知识(如代数、几何、概率论等)会对编程有所帮助。

    2. 学习算法和数据结构:算法和数据结构是编程的核心。学习算法和数据结构可以帮助你更好地解决问题和优化代码。

    3. 掌握一门编程语言:选择一门常用的编程语言,如Python、Java、C++等,并深入学习它。通过实践编写代码,了解语言的基础语法、数据结构和算法。

    4. 学会使用开发工具:学习使用常见的开发工具,如集成开发环境(IDE)、文本编辑器、调试器等。这些工具可以提高你的开发效率。

    5. 网络基础知识:了解计算机网络的基础知识,包括TCP/IP协议、HTTP、网络安全等。这对于开发网络应用和理解互联网工作原理很有帮助。

    6. 实战项目经验:通过参与实际的项目,锻炼编程技能。可以参加开源项目、编程竞赛、实习等活动,提高自己的编程能力和经验。

    尽管没有特定的学历要求,但学习编程仍然需要自己付出努力和时间。通过自学、参加在线课程和培训等方式,你可以掌握编程技能,并建立自己的编程能力和经验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部